- The City Wall of Pingyao is one of the well-preserved city walls in China. In 1997, Pingyao City Wall along with Pingyao Ancient Town was listed as one of the World Cultural Heritage. It was originally built in the West Zhou Dynasty (11th century BC - 771 BC), but the current one was the remains of the City Wall rebuilt in the Ming Dynasty (1368-1644).
